Unit 7 ArtLesson 3 A Musical Genius【教学目标】Students will be able to1. read and talk about Ludwig van Beethoven2. read for deep understanding3. summarise information4. learn about and practise word building【教学重难点】1. reading for deep understand2. summarising information【教学过程】1. What do you know about Ludwig van Beethoven?(1) Read aloud the title of the lesson and the four questions. Discuss any difficult words or terminology.(2) Students answer the questions independently as a benchmark assessment.2. Scan the story and answer questions.(1) Ask volunteer students to read the italicised paragraph and the first paragraph.(2) Give students a few moments to correct their answers in Activity 1.(3) Discuss the answers as a class.3. Read and find out.(1) Read the Skill Builder. Draw a diagram to show the main information of the passage and how the passage is structured. Let’s read the passage to find details on Symphony No. 9 and supporting sentences.(2) V olunteer students read the story.(3) In pairs, while listening, students add the details to the diagram. Support students as they complete the task.(4) Encourage students to answer the questions in the Skill Builder about the passage that theyhave just read.(5) Discuss the answers as a class.4. Take notes and answer questions.(1) Students volunteer to each read a few sentences of the text.(2) Divide students into groups based on their reading level. Allow high level readers to read independently and complete the activity alone. Encourage middle level readers to read the account quietly and work together to find the answers. Support low level readers by listening as they read the account aloud and explaining unknown terms and tricky sentence structures. If necessary, provide sentence frames for low level readers to complete in order to answer the questions.(3) Discuss the answers as a class.5. Pair Work: Choose a topic to introduce to your partner.(1) Students choose a topic and mind map information on that topic.(2) Using those ideas and the discussed vocabulary, students write at least five sentences. High level learners can research further and write more information.(3) In pairs, students read their sentences to their partner and review what they have learnt.6. Group Work: Think and share.(1) Divide students into groups to answer the questions and provide logical reasoning.(2) Discuss the answers as a class.7. Complete sentences on page 16.(1) V olunteer students can read the phrases in the box and the sentence frames. Discuss any difficult words or terms.(2) Encourage students to work independently and not to turn back to the passage, to complete the sentences by filling in the terms.(3) Students can read their sentences to a partner to hear that they sound correct.(4) Discuss the answers as a class.8. Complete the Word Builder on page 17.(1) Instruct students that they will use their dictionaries to assist with completing the table.(2) Ask students to look up one of the words in their dictionary.a. What part of speech is it? How do you know?b. What is the verb form? How do you know? What is the adjective form?c. How did the word change?(3) Divide students into groups based on their reading level. Allow high level readers to complete the activity alone. Encourage middle level readers to work together to find the answers. Support low level readers to complete the Word Builder by providing guidance with dictionary skills.(4) Discuss the answers as a class.9. Complete sentences.(1) V olunteer students read the sentence frames. Explain any difficult words or terms.(2) Divide students into groups based on their reading level. Allow high level readers to complete the activity alone. Encourage middle level readers to work together to complete the sentences. Support low level readers by providing a key with the answers that they can choose from.(3) Discuss the answers as a class.10. Pair Work: Which part of the story impressed you most? Why?(1) In pairs, students discuss what impressed them most about the passage and what they learnt.(2) Each student shares their answer with the class.。

2021学年度北师大版新教材必修三Unit7 ArtLesson-3 A Musical Genius教学设计本节课是高中英语第三册Unit 7 Art的第三课A Musical Genius,课型是阅读课。

介绍了伟大音乐家贝多芬的故事。

贝多芬的事迹大家都很熟悉,但其是如何创作D小调第九交响曲以及第一次登台演出的故事却鲜为人知。

本课的故事就讲述了失聪后的贝多芬在是如何创作出D 小调第九交响曲以及在第一次演出中大获成功,获得全场观众的喝彩,观众对于他失聪的事很震惊,借此来表达音乐奇才贝多芬的伟大事迹。

通过本节课的学习,让学生了解音乐天才贝多芬的故事,告诉学生不管面对什么困难,永不言弃才是克服困难的办法。

1.语言技能目标(1)学生能够借助关键词,在理解文章大意的基础上,找出段落主题句,完成读前问题;(2)用所学的词汇和语言的对课文进行复述。

2.语言知识目标(1)能够正确运用以下单词和短语:genius, composer, be regarded as..., inspire, symphony, opera, minor, respond, atmosphere, tense, orchestra, hesitate, applaud, joyous, clap, a broad smile等;(2)能正确使用同根词,如joy(n.)→enjoy(v.)等。

3.文化意识目标(1)了解音乐天才贝多芬的故事;(2)正确认识生活、学习中的困难,学会如何克服困难。

4.情感态度目标正确认识和面对生活、学习中出现的困境,学会不轻易放弃,从而摆脱困境。

1.重点(1)如何使用地道的英语表达对音乐天才贝多芬的故事的理解;(2)正确理解并运用英语同根词。

2. 难点(1)能用得体的英语表达值得钦佩的人以及其是如何克服困难的;(2)能正确识别和运用英语中同根词。
